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This ensures your filet mignon cooks evenly.
- Rub the filet mignon steaks generously with olive oil, then season both sides liberally with salt, black pepper, and garlic powder.
- For an enhanced flavor profile, sprinkle chopped rosemary or thyme on the steaks.
Cooking
- Heat a heavy-bottomed cast iron sk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, sear the steaks for 2-3 minutes on each side until browned.
- If desired, add a pat of butter on top of each steak for additional richness.
-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ven. Bake for 6-10 minutes, depending on your preferred level of doneness (6 for rare, 10 for medium).
Serving
- Remove the skillet from the oven and let the steaks rest for a few minutes to enhance flavor.
- Slice the steak against the grain and fan out the pieces on a warm plate. Drizzle the savory juices from the skillet over the top and garnish with fresh herbs.
